Future Scope & Benefits of PGD in Transport Management

Transportation is the backbone of any economy, and efficient transport management is crucial for the movement of goods and people. A Post Graduate Diploma in Transport Management equips individuals with specialized knowledge and skills in the field of transportation. Here's an in-depth exploration of the future scope and benefits of pursuing PGD in TM:

PGD in Transport Management Future Scope

  1. Transportation Manager: Graduates can pursue careers as transportation managers in logistics companies, manufacturing firms, and government agencies. They are responsible for optimizing transportation operations, reducing costs, and ensuring timely deliveries.


  2. Logistics Analyst: Logistics analysts focus on data analysis, route optimization, and logistics strategy development to enhance transportation efficiency and cost-effectiveness.


  3. Supply Chain Manager: Supply chain managers oversee the entire supply chain process, including transportation. They ensure seamless coordination between suppliers, manufacturers, and distributors.


  4. Freight Broker: Graduates can work as freight brokers, facilitating the shipment of goods by connecting shippers with carriers. They negotiate rates, manage logistics, and ensure timely deliveries.


  5. Transportation Planner: Transportation planners are responsible for designing transportation networks, routes, and schedules to optimize efficiency and minimize environmental impact.


  6. Government Transportation Officer: Some graduates may choose to work for government transportation departments, focusing on transportation policy development, infrastructure planning, and regulatory compliance.


  7. Sustainability Consultant: With the growing emphasis on sustainability in transportation, graduates can become sustainability consultants, advising organizations on eco-friendly transportation practices and technologies.

PGD in Transport Management Benefits

  1. High Demand: Transport management professionals are in high demand across industries, ensuring job security and numerous career opportunities.


  2. Diverse Career Paths: Graduates can explore diverse career paths within transportation, including logistics, supply chain management, and sustainable transport initiatives.


  3. Global Opportunities: Transportation is a global industry, offering graduates the chance to work on international projects and collaborate with organizations worldwide.


  4. Problem-Solving Skills: Graduates develop strong analytical and problem-solving skills, which are valuable in transportation and related fields.


  5. Competitive Salaries: Transport management positions often come with competitive salaries and benefits, recognizing the critical role they play in business operations.


  6. Sustainability Focus: Many organizations are seeking to reduce their carbon footprint through sustainable transportation practices, providing graduates with opportunities to work on eco-friendly initiatives.


  7. Continuous Learning: The transportation industry continually evolves with advancements in technology and sustainability practices, offering professionals ongoing opportunities for learning and growth.
